Thomas Nolan Fielder1,2,3
ID# 22575, (1861 - 1930)
Father | George L. Fielder4,5 (15 Mar 1830 - 27 Oct 1909) |
Mother | Sarah E. Britton4,6 (28 Jan 1828 - 18 Feb 1889) |

Narrative:
Thomas Nolan Fielder was born on 17 Jun 1861 in Mississippi
He moved to Louisiana


He moved to Texas


Thomas has not been found in the 1900 census.
Thomas married Jessie Edna Cooke, daughter of Jim B. Cooke and Mary [surname unknown], on 13 Oct 1909 in Cooke Co., Texas

He was a farmer.17,18,19
Thomas and Jessie appeared on the 1910 Federal Census of Clay Co., Texas, on Blue Grove Road

Thomas and Jessie appeared on the 1920 Federal Census of Cooke Co., Texas

Thomas and Jessie appeared on the 1930 Federal Census of Cooke Co., Texas, on Hood Road

Thomas died on 12 Nov 1930 in Myra, Cooke Co., Texas
